Brasserie la Petite Ramonière
La Petite Ramonière is a brewery located in the marshes of Notre Dame de Monts.
Beers are brewed from cereals grown on the farm. Cereal cultivation and beer production are done in respect to local nature and biodiversity.
Ingrid and François settled in the heart of the marshes in 2012 to create the La Petite Ramonière brewery farm and wanted to bring together their commitment to their activity and their values.
It is with pleasure they invite visitors to their farm so that they can share, not just an understanding of how to brew beer but also their passion for their work.
During the visits, you will be able to discuss history, beers, agriculture, energy, biodiversity, tastes and malts. You will experience the difference between barley and wheat beers, beers brewed with the crops or cultures of the moment. All of their beers are named after birds living in the marshes.
The visits are free and last approximately 1.5 hour. They are family-friendly and end with a tasting of different beers.
Visits take place on Tuesdays and Wednesdays at 5pm booked in advance during the summer season and by appointment during the rest of the year.
You will find beers on direct sale at the farm, at the farmers' markets and in all the good wine and grocery stores in the local area.
The farm shop is open all year round on Tuesdays and Wednesdays from 5pm to 7pm and on Saturday mornings between 10am and 12pm.
